 Rock ClimbingKids will feel like professions as they climb rocks on the oceans edge Very professional and friendly guides at both of the two climbing schools in town. |  BikingCar free carriage roads run through Acadia making it a great place for family cycling |  Hiking- Great hiking destination for families with a range of options from very easy to strenuous. Hike through forests to rocky shores, along granite ledges or up Acadia Mountain. There are gorgeous views and lots to stop and do along the way. |

 Horseback RidingWith forty-five miles of rustic carriage roads weaving through the mountains and valleys of the park, Acadia is a wonderful place to get your whole family up on horseback. |  Bar HarborWith great shops, interactive family theater, great restaurants and ice cream shops Bar Harbor is the perfect family friendly town. |  Marine BiologyYour kids will be fascinated as they go along on a live underwater dive with Diver Ed's Dive in Theater. |

 TidepoolingA land bridge that opens up at low tide becomes a great place to see lots of the sea creatures that call Frenchman Bay Home. Take a walk across to Bar Island for a hike before high tide comes back to cover that bridge |
